F1's 2019 wing changes a ‘big hit' to teams

We, for good reason, have been focused on the 2020 regulation changes but there are 2019 front and rear wing changes that will impact the car performance for all the teams this year. How much it will impact the performance is anyone’s guess but as Autosport points out, it could be significant. According to Racing Point’s technical director, Andy Green, the simplified front and rear wings may be a real challenge for the teams. 'It's been a big hit,' he told Autosport. 'And when we first put it in the tunnel a few months ago, we're talking a few seconds of lap time, and a poorly balanced car as well. 'It was the worst possible outcome.
